Legal Weapon: Life Sentence to Love [MCA, 1988]
Kat Arthur makes her belated major-label debut too damn late, carrying the eternal Joan Jett comparison far into love-is-pain cliché. The tunes are even further from Jett's best than Jett's latest, with the dark undertow that once colored Brian Hansen's music succumbing to upbeat hooks that rise out of the locomotion like bluebirds fluttering hopefully around Kat's erotic doom.
B-
